Output 5efb900400d5c387b4a8d79e88da6ab8574e71642a892c39e52c2934532ec687:0

value
2535407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ca42dd7f7002eba05c72656c3e3ff6b7e9333a5 OP_EQUAL
address
38gFxV67AM8RTmpDntNr9T71ynuRnjrHgE
transaction
5efb900400d5c387b4a8d79e88da6ab8574e71642a892c39e52c2934532ec687
spent
true